The 2014 Maserati Quattroporte, a flagship sedan from the Italian luxury brand, embodies a blend of performance and elegance. This sixth-generation model (2013-present) features a sleek four-door sedan body style. Key trims include the Quattroporte S Q4 (all-wheel drive) and the GTS. Its pricing range when new was approximately $100,000 to $150,000+. Its unique Italian design, powerful engine options, and exclusive brand image contributed to its popularity.
The Good

The 2014 Quattroporte offers thrilling performance with powerful engine options and responsive handling, appealing to the emotional buyer. Its luxurious interior and comfortable ride cater to practicality. The striking Italian design and exclusivity provide an emotional draw, while the spacious cabin and available all-wheel drive add practical value. However, reliability may be a concern.

The Bad

Potential weaknesses of the 2014 Maserati Quattroporte include questionable long-term reliability, with potential issues in the electrical systems and infotainment. Maintenance and repair costs can be high. Depreciation is also a factor to consider. Prospective buyers should thoroughly inspect the car's service history and consider a pre-purchase inspection.

2014 Maserati Quattroporte: Quick Overview

Here's a summary of the 2014 Maserati Quattroporte's key specifications:

  • Engine Options:
    • 3.0L Twin-Turbo V6: Available in two states of tune.
    • 3.8L Twin-Turbo V8 (GTS).
  • Horsepower:
    • 3.0L V6: Approximately 404 hp (varies slightly depending on the specific tune).
    • 3.8L V8: Approximately 523 hp.
  • Fuel Economy (EPA Estimated):
    • 3.0L V6: Around 15-16 mpg city / 24 mpg highway (RWD). AWD models slightly lower.
    • 3.8L V8: Around 13 mpg city / 22 mpg highway.
  • 0-60 mph Times:
    • 3.0L V6: Around 5.0-5.1 seconds.
    • 3.8L V8: Around 4.6-4.7 seconds.
  • Towing Capacity: Not designed for towing; no official towing capacity is listed.
  • Trim-Level Features:
    • Base/S: Leather upholstery, navigation system, premium sound system, sunroof, power-adjustable seats, dual-zone climate control.
    • S Q4: Adds all-wheel drive.
    • GTS: Upgraded leather, sport-tuned suspension, unique styling cues, more powerful engine, carbon fiber interior trim.
Many options were available, allowing for further customization regardless of the trim level.

What Problems Does the 2014 Maserati Quattroporte Have?

The 2014 Maserati Quattroporte has been known to have some reliability concerns. Frequently reported problems include issues with the electrical system, such as malfunctioning sensors and infotainment glitches. Some owners have reported problems with the transmission, particularly with rough shifting or delays. The infotainment system, while visually appealing, can be slow to respond and prone to freezing.
Recalls have been issued for various issues, including potential fuel leaks and problems with the brake system. It's essential to check the vehicle's VIN for any outstanding recalls. Long-term reliability can be a concern, with reports of increased maintenance needs as the car ages. Specifically, issues with the air suspension system, if equipped, can be costly to repair. Furthermore, oil leaks and cooling system problems have been noted by some owners. While not all 2014 Quattroportes experience these issues, prospective buyers should be aware of these potential problems and thoroughly inspect the vehicle's maintenance history and consider a pre-purchase inspection by a qualified mechanic specializing in Italian cars.

How long will the 2014 Maserati Quattroporte last?

Based on owner data and typical maintenance habits, a 2014 Maserati Quattroporte can reasonably be expected to provide 150,000 to 200,000 miles of service with proper care. However, its long-term durability is often challenged by potential issues. Common weaknesses emerging over time include electrical problems, issues with the air suspension (if equipped), and increased maintenance needs related to the engine and transmission. Regular maintenance, including timely oil changes and inspections, is crucial for maximizing its lifespan. Neglecting maintenance can significantly shorten its service life and lead to expensive repairs.

What Technology & Safety Features are Included?

The 2014 Maserati Quattroporte features a respectable array of built-in tech and safety features for its time. The infotainment system includes an 8.4-inch touchscreen display with navigation, Bluetooth connectivity, and a premium sound system (options included Bowers & Wilkins).
Driver-assistance features include standard features like a rearview camera, parking sensors, and stability control. Optional features included blind-spot monitoring and adaptive cruise control.
Safety features encompass standard airbags, anti-lock brakes, and electronic brakeforce distribution.
Crash-test ratings from agencies like the NHTSA and IIHS may be available, and should be consulted to assess the vehicle's safety performance. These ratings can vary depending on the specific model year and testing criteria. While the infotainment system was advanced for its time, it may feel dated compared to modern systems. Overall, the Quattroporte offered a blend of luxury and technology, although some features were optional.

2014 Maserati Quattroporte Prices and Market Value

When new, the 2014 Maserati Quattroporte had a price range of approximately $100,000 to $150,000+, depending on the trim level and options. On the used market, prices can range from approximately $20,000 to $40,000 or even lower, depending on condition, mileage, and history. The Quattroporte experiences significant depreciation, typical of luxury vehicles, especially those with higher maintenance costs. Factors affecting resale value include the vehicle's condition, mileage, service history, and the presence of desirable options. Cars with a well-documented service history and in excellent condition command higher prices.

2014 Maserati Quattroporte Cost of Ownership

The 2014 Maserati Quattroporte is a costly vehicle to own long-term. Insurance premiums are relatively high due to its luxury status and performance capabilities. Fuel costs can be substantial, especially with the V8 engine. Maintenance and repair costs are significantly higher than average, owing to the specialized parts and labor required. Regular maintenance is essential, but even routine services can be expensive. Overall, prospective owners should be prepared for considerable ownership expenses.

2014 Maserati Quattroporte Recalls & Defects

Vehicle Speed Control:accelerator Pedal
Recall date 2016-03-01
Recall no. 16v122000
Source NHTSA
Summary Maserati North America, Inc. (Maserati) IS Recalling Certain Model Year 2014-2016 Quattroporte and Ghibli Vehicles Manufactured February 1, 2013, TO November 30, 2015. IN THE Affected Vehicles, THE Driver-Side Floor MAT Anchor MAY Break Allowing THE Floor MAT TO Move and GET Trapped Between THE Accelerator Pedal and THE Vehicle Carpet.
Consequence IF THE Floor MAT Moves and Becomes Trapped Between THE Accelerator and THE Vehicle Carpet, IT MAY Result IN Very High Vehicle Speeds, Which Could Cause A Crash, Serious Injury or Death.
Remedy Maserati Will Notify Owners, and Dealers Will Replace THE Driver-Side Floor MAT and Possibly THE Accelerator Pedal Cover, Free OF Charge. THE Recall Began April 29, 2016. Owners MAY Contact Maserati Customer Service AT 1-877-696-2737. Maserati's Number FOR This Recall IS 301. Note: These Vehicles ARE Equipped With A Brake Override System. IN THE Event A Pedal IS Trapped, Pushing ON THE Brake Pedal Will Brake THE Vehicle and Enable THE Driver TO Slow and Stop and Turn OFF THE Vehicle.
Notes Owners MAY Also Contact THE National Highway Traffic Safety Administration Vehicle Safety Hotline AT 1-888-327-4236 (Tty 1-800-424-9153), or GO TO Www.safercar.gov.

Power Train:automatic Transmission:control Module (Tcm/Pcm/Tecm)
Recall date 2016-06-10
Recall no. 16v424000
Source NHTSA
Summary Maserati North America, Inc. (Maserati) IS Recalling Certain Model Year 2014 Quattroporte and Ghibli Vehicles Manufactured June 1, 2013, TO February 28, 2014. THE Affected Vehicles, Equipped With AN Eight-Speed Automatic Transmission and A Monostable Gear Selector, MAY Mislead Owners About Which Gear THE Vehicle IS IN and MAY NOT Adequately Warn THE Driver When Driver's Door IS Opened and THE Vehicle IS NOT IN Park, Allowing Them TO Exit THE Vehicle While THE Vehicle IS Still IN Gear.
Consequence Drivers Thinking That Their Vehicle's Transmission IS IN THE Park Position MAY BE Struck BY THE Vehicle and Injured IF They Attempt TO GET OUT OF THE Vehicle While THE Engine IS Running and THE Parking Brake IS NOT Engaged.
Remedy Maserati Will Notify Owners, and Dealers Will Perform A Software Update, Free OF Charge. THE Remedy Software IS Currently IN Development. Owners Were Mailed AN Interim Notification ON July 1, 2016. A Second Notice Will BE Mailed When THE Software IS Available. Owners MAY Contact Maserati Customer Service AT 1-877-696-2737. Maserati's Number FOR This Recall IS 307.
Notes Owners MAY Also Contact THE National Highway Traffic Safety Administration Vehicle Safety Hotline AT 1-888-327-4236 (Tty 1-800-424-9153), or GO TO Www.safercar.gov.

Suspension:rear
Recall date 2016-05-02
Recall no. 16v264000
Source NHTSA
Summary Maserati North America, Inc. (Maserati) IS Recalling Certain Model Year 2014-2016 Quattroporte and Ghibli Vehicles Manufactured February 1, 2013, TO September 18, 2015. During THE Assembly Process, THE Rear Tie-Rod TO HUB Assembly Attaching Bolt MAY NOT Have Been Properly Tightened.
Consequence AN Improperly Tightened Rear Tie-Rod TO HUB Carrier Assembly Attaching Bolt MAY Allow THE Tie-Rod TO Separate From THE HUB Carrier, Resulting IN A Loss OF Control, Increasing THE Risk OF A Crash.
Remedy Maserati Will Notify Owners, and Dealers Will Inspect THE Left and Right Rear Tie-Rod TO HUB Carrier Assembly Attaching Bolts TO Verify That They ARE Properly Tightened, Replacing THE Rear Tie-Rod TO HUB Carrier Assembly AS Necessary, Free OF Charge. THE Recall IS Expected TO Begin During July 2016. Owners MAY Contact Maserati Customer Service AT 1-877-696-2737. Maserati's Number FOR This Recall IS 303.
Notes Owners MAY Also Contact THE National Highway Traffic Safety Administration Vehicle Safety Hotline AT 1-888-327-4236 (Tty 1-800-424-9153), or GO TO Www.safercar.gov.
Fuel System, Gasoline:delivery:hoses, Lines/Piping, and Fittings
Recall date 2014-10-17
Recall no. 14v654000
Source NHTSA
Summary Maserati North America, Inc. (Maserati) IS Recalling Certain Model Year 2014-2015 Quattroporte, and Ghibli Vehicles Manufactured July 23, 2014, TO August 7, 2014. THE Fuel Delivery Hoses IN THE Vehicles MAY Have Been Improperly Crimped.
Consequence THE Improper Crimp CAN Cause A Fuel Leak And, IN THE Presence OF AN Ignition Source, Could Result IN A Fire.
Remedy Maserati Will Notify Owners, and Dealers Will Replace THE Entire Fuel Delivery Line, Free OF Charge. THE Recall Began IN October 2014. Owners MAY Contact Maserati Customer Service AT 1-877-696-2737. Maserati's Number FOR This Recall IS 256.
Notes Owners MAY Also Contact THE National Highway Traffic Safety Administration Vehicle Safety Hotline AT 1-888-327-4236 (Tty 1-800-424-9153), or GO TO Www.safercar.gov.
Electrical System:wiring
Recall date 2017-01-20
Recall no. 17v046000
Source NHTSA
Summary Maserati North America, Inc. (Maserati) IS Recalling Certain 2014-2017 Quattroporte and Ghibli, and 2017 Levante Vehicles. Adjusting THE Front Seats MAY Cause THE Seat Wiring Harness TO Rub, Possibly Resulting IN AN Electrical Short.
Consequence AN Electrical Short CAN Increase THE Risk OF A Fire.
Remedy Maserati Will Notify Owners, and Dealers Will Inspect THE Vehicles, Replacing THE Seat Wiring Harness, AS Necessary, Free OF Charge. THE Recall Began June 26, 2017. Owners MAY Contact Maserati Customer Service AT 1-877-696-2737. Maserati's Number FOR This Recall IS 342.
Notes Owners MAY Also Contact THE National Highway Traffic Safety Administration Vehicle Safety Hotline AT 1-888-327-4236 (Tty 1-800-424-9153), or GO TO Www.safercar.gov.

Fuel System, Gasoline:delivery:hoses, Lines/Piping, and Fittings
Recall date 2018-11-26
Recall no. 18v831000
Source NHTSA
Summary Maserati North America, Inc. (Maserati) IS Recalling Certain 2014-2015 Maserati Quattroporte and Ghibli Vehicles. During Production OF THE Fuel Lines, THE Lines MAY Have Been Damaged, Possibly Resulting IN A Fuel Leak.
Consequence A Fuel Leak IN THE Presence OF AN Ignition Source CAN Increase THE Risk OF A Fire.
Remedy Maserati Will Notify Owners, and Dealers Will Replace THE Fuel Line Assemblies, Free OF Charge, Unless Previously Repaired Under Recall 17v-045. THE Recall Began January 15, 2019. Owners MAY Contact Maserati Customer Service AT 1-877-696-2737. Maserati's Number FOR This Recall IS 378. Note: This Recall Supersedes Recall Number 17v-045.
Notes Owners MAY Also Contact THE National Highway Traffic Safety Administration Vehicle Safety Hotline AT 1-888-327-4236 (Tty 1-800-424-9153), or GO TO Www.safercar.gov.

How Does the 2014 Maserati Quattroporte Compare to Other Sedan?

The 2014 Maserati Quattroporte competes with luxury sedans like the BMW 7 Series, Mercedes-Benz S-Class, Audi A8, and Porsche Panamera. In terms of performance and styling, the Quattroporte offers a unique Italian flair and engaging driving experience, but it falls short of the German rivals in reliability and build quality. Feature-wise, it's comparable, but the infotainment can be less intuitive than those in the German cars.
Price-wise, used Quattroportes can be attractive, but potential maintenance costs are a major factor.
Alternatives to consider are:
  • **Mercedes-Benz S-Class:** Offers superior comfort, technology, and reliability.
  • **BMW 7 Series:** Provides a balance of performance and luxury with better reliability.
  • **Porsche Panamera:** Delivers sportier handling and a more modern interior.
  • **Audi A8:** Combines luxury, technology, and all-wheel-drive capability.
These alternatives generally offer better long-term reliability and potentially lower running costs. If reliability is a top concern, the German alternatives are generally safer bets.

Final Verdict: Is the 2014 Maserati Quattroporte a Good Sedan?

The 2014 Maserati Quattroporte is ideal for buyers who prioritize style, performance, and exclusivity over long-term reliability. It's worth buying used if you're willing to accept the potential for higher maintenance costs and have a trusted mechanic familiar with Italian cars. A well-maintained example with a comprehensive service history is crucial. Consider a GTS model for the ultimate performance experience, but be aware of the increased running costs. If reliability is a primary concern, exploring alternatives like the Mercedes-Benz S-Class or BMW 7 Series would be wise.
